Businessman murdered
published: Wednesday | November 27, 2002

A 41-YEAR-OLD businessman was shot dead and his licensed firearm stolen by unknown assailant(s) at Fairmount district, Sheffield in Westmoreland on Monday night.

He has been identified as Elvis Whyte otherwise called "Sekie" of Rocky Hill in the parish.

Reports from the CCN's Westmoreland Liaison Officer are that 11:15 p.m., Mr. Whyte went to Sheffield to visit the mother of his child. On leaving several explosions were heard. On investigation Mr.Whyte was found beside his car suffering from gunshot wounds to the head and chest. He was taken to the Savanna-la-mar Hospital where he was pronounced dead.

The Negril police who are investigating say the killer(s) stole Mr. Whyte's loaded Smith and Wesson pistol, serial #VJB8499. An additional magazine containing 15 rounds of ammunition, $76,000 and US$90 were found at the scene.
